Key facts about Qfqual listed Diploma Health Social Care Level 5 Course
The QFQUAL listed Diploma in Health and Social Care Level 5 Course is a comprehensive qualification that equips learners with the knowledge and skills required to work in the health and social care sector.
Learning outcomes of this course include understanding the principles of health and social care, developing effective communication and interpersonal skills, and applying knowledge of health and wellbeing to support individuals and communities.
The duration of this course is typically 12 months, with learners required to complete a minimum of 120 credits to achieve the full diploma.
The Diploma in Health and Social Care Level 5 Course is highly relevant to the industry, as it provides learners with the skills and knowledge required to work in a variety of roles, including health and social care professionals, support workers, and care managers.
Industry relevance is further enhanced by the course's focus on current issues and trends in health and social care, such as mental health, dementia, and the importance of person-centred care.
Graduates of this course can pursue a range of career opportunities, including roles in hospitals, care homes, community health services, and voluntary sector organizations.
The QFQUAL listed Diploma in Health and Social Care Level 5 Course is accredited by the relevant awarding body, ensuring that learners receive a high-quality education that is recognized by employers and industry leaders.
